{"product_id":"interactive-css-beyond-hover-states-for-enhanced-user-experience-utilize-focus-target-and-advanced-state-management-for-dynamic-web-interactions-9798292460626","title":"Interactive CSS: Beyond Hover States for Enhanced User Experience: Utilize: focus,: target, and Advanced State Management for Dynamic Web Interactions","description":"\u003cp\u003e • Author(s): Pythquill Publishing\u003cbr\u003e • Publisher: Independently Published\u003cbr\u003e • Publisher Imprint: Independently Published\u003cbr\u003e • BISAC: Languages - General\u003c\/p\u003e\u003cp\u003e\u003c\/p\u003e\u003cp\u003e✅ \u003cb\u003eMaster Foundational CSS Interactivity\u003c\/b\u003e: Gain a comprehensive understanding of how CSS pseudo-classes like: hover: focus, and: target enable dynamic web interactions.\u003c\/p\u003e\u003cp\u003e✅ \u003cb\u003eImplement Robust Focus Management\u003c\/b\u003e: Learn to style the focus state effectively using: focus: focus-within, and: focus-visible to ensure excellent keyboard navigation and accessibility.\u003c\/p\u003e\u003cp\u003e✅ \u003cb\u003eLeverage URL Fragments with: target\u003c\/b\u003e: Discover how to use the: target pseudo-class for in-page navigation, content toggling, and persistent state indication in pure CSS.\u003c\/p\u003e\u003cp\u003e✅ \u003cb\u003eManage CSS-Driven Component States\u003c\/b\u003e: Understand core CSS state management principles and how to apply pseudo-classes like: checked: disabled: valid, and attribute selectors to control UI elements without JavaScript.\u003c\/p\u003e\u003cp\u003e✅ \u003cb\u003eBuild CSS-Only Interactive Patterns\u003c\/b\u003e: Acquire the skills to create complex UI components such as accordions, tabbed interfaces, and even off-canvas menus using pure CSS techniques like the \"checkbox hack\" and sibling combinators.\u003c\/p\u003e\u003cp\u003e✅ \u003cb\u003eEnhance User Experience with Transitions and Animations\u003c\/b\u003e: Apply CSS transitions and keyframe animations to create smooth and engaging visual feedback for state changes.\u003c\/p\u003e\u003cp\u003e✅ \u003cb\u003eIntegrate CSS with JavaScript for Advanced Interactions\u003c\/b\u003e: Learn how JavaScript can expose state to CSS through class manipulation, data attributes, and ARIA attributes for more complex and accessible solutions.\u003c\/p\u003e\u003cp\u003e✅ \u003cb\u003eDevelop Accessible Web Interfaces\u003c\/b\u003e: Understand the critical importance of accessibility in interactive design, particularly concerning focus indicators, and identify when CSS-only solutions may fall short for full accessibility requirements.\u003c\/p\u003e\u003cp\u003e✅ \u003cb\u003eOptimize Performance of Interactive Elements\u003c\/b\u003e: Gain insights into how complex selectors, transitions, and animations impact performance and learn best practices to ensure smooth user experiences.\u003c\/p\u003e\u003cp\u003e✅ \u003cb\u003eTroubleshoot and Debug Interactive CSS\u003c\/b\u003e: Become proficient in using browser developer tools to inspect element states and diagnose issues in your interactive CSS implementations.\u003c\/p\u003e\u003cp\u003e✅ \u003cb\u003eEvaluate When to Use CSS vs. JavaScript\u003c\/b\u003e: Develop the ability to discern the strengths and limitations of CSS-only interactions versus those requiring JavaScript, making informed decisions for your projects.\u003c\/p\u003e","brand":"Independently Published","offers":[{"title":"Paperback","offer_id":47594812670103,"sku":"9798292460626","price":2508.0,"currency_code":"INR","in_stock":false}],"thumbnail_url":"\/\/cdn.shopify.com\/s\/files\/1\/0666\/3471\/1191\/files\/9798292460626.webp?v=1774987280","url":"https:\/\/atlanticbooks.com\/products\/interactive-css-beyond-hover-states-for-enhanced-user-experience-utilize-focus-target-and-advanced-state-management-for-dynamic-web-interactions-9798292460626","provider":"Atlantic Books","version":"1.0","type":"link"}